欢迎来到科站长!

PostgreSQL

当前位置: 主页 > 数据库 > PostgreSQL

关于postgresql时间转时间戳的信息

时间:2026-02-06 22:06:45|栏目:PostgreSQL|点击:

postgresql数据库创建时间怎么查

1、在PostgreSQL中,查看数据库的创建时间并不是直接支持的功能,但可以通过一些间接的方法来实现。

关于postgresql时间转时间戳的信息

2、方法3:CN日志查看方法 CN 日志记录了数据库的 DDL(数据定义语言)信息,通过配置日志记录策略,可以追踪表的创建时间。 **配置日志记录**:修改配置文件 postgresql.conf,设置日志记录策略。 **创建测试表**:执行与上述方法相同的操作。

3、在Navicat中查看关系型数据库查询的运行时间的方法如下:MySQL: 使用Navicat Premium时,可以通过SQL Profiler功能启用分析。 执行查询后,在分析结果中查看Duration列,即可获取查询的运行时间。 SQL Profiler还提供相应的SQL查询来计算总时间。

4、基础用法查询当前时间直接在SELECT语句中使用:SELECT NOW();返回格式如:2024-07-20 14:30:45(具体格式因数据库而异)。

关于postgresql时间转时间戳的信息

interval时间间隔

INTERVAL 数据类型语法INTERVAL 精度 单位精度:指定时间间隔的小数位数(如秒的小数部分)。单位:支持以下时间单位:单一单位:YEAR、MONTH、DAY、HOUR、MINUTE、SECOND。复合单位:YEAR TO MONTH、DAY TO HOUR、DAY TO MINUTE、DAY TO SECOND。

在PostgreSQL中,计算两个日期之间的时间间隔并仅获取天数间隔的步骤如下:直接使用日期减法:可以直接通过两个日期相减得到一个interval类型的结果,例如SELECT timestamp 20180401 date 20180328;,这会返回4 days。但这种方式的结果包含了单位,如果只需要数字,则需要进行进一步转换。

格式:INTERVAL [+|][y][m] [YEAR[]][TO MONTH]参数说明:[+|]:可选的指示符,用于说明时间间隔是正数还是负数。y:可选参数,表示时间间隔的年数部分。m:可选参数,表示时间间隔的月数部分。如果指定了年数和月数,必须在INTERVAL子句中包含TO MONTH。

关于postgresql时间转时间戳的信息

查询时间间隔 使用 SELECT timestamp 2018-04-01 - date 2018-03-28; 可以得到结果4 days,但我们需要的是4,单位是天。转换方法如下:使用 select extract(epoch from timestamp 2018-04-01 - date 2018-03-28); 查询,结果是345600秒,换算成小时是96,换算成天就是4。

interval的意思是间隔。以下是关于interval一词的详细解释:时间间隔:在时间领域,interval指的是两个事件或时刻之间的时间距离。例如,早上八点到下午三点的时间间隔是七小时。空间间隔:在空间领域,interval指的是两个物体之间的距离或位置差异。

在sql中如何将时间戳转换成日期呢?

对于 SQL Server,时间戳是以毫秒为单位表示日期和时间的组合,可以通过 CAST 或 CONVERT 函数转换为日期。示例代码如下:sql SELECT CAST(时间戳 AS DATETIME) as date;而在 Oracle 数据库中,使用 TO_DATE 或 TO_CHAR 函数可以将时间戳转换为日期格式。

若时间戳是Unix时间戳,需用TO_TIMESTAMP先转换。

在MySQL中,将13位毫秒级时间戳转换为YYYY-MM-DD格式的核心思路是先除以1000转为秒级时间戳,再通过FROM_UNIXTIME函数转换为日期时间,最后使用DATE_FORMAT、DATE或CAST等函数提取日期部分。

答案:可以使用SQL中的FROM_UNIXTIME函数将时间戳转换为正常的时间格式。

上一篇:postgresql查看所有分区的语句(plsql查看分区)

栏    目:PostgreSQL

下一篇:查看postgresql(查看postGRESQL服务状态)

本文标题:关于postgresql时间转时间戳的信息

本文地址:https://fushidao.cc/shujuku/52227.html

广告投放 | 联系我们 | 版权申明

作者声明:本站作品含AI生成内容,所有的文章、图片、评论等,均由网友发表或百度AI生成内容,属个人行为,与本站立场无关。

如果侵犯了您的权利,请与我们联系,我们将在24小时内进行处理、任何非本站因素导致的法律后果,本站均不负任何责任。

联系QQ:66551466 | 邮箱:66551466@qq.com

Copyright © 2018-2026 科站长 版权所有鄂ICP备2024089280号